Removing racks/trays support frames
Removing the rack/tray support frames enables
the sides to be cleaned more easily.
To remove the rack/tray support frames:
Pull the frame towards the inside of the oven
cavity to unhook it from its groove A, then
slide it out of the seats B at the back.
When cleaning is complete, repeat the
above procedures to put the rack/tray
support frames back in.
On pizza models only:
Remove in sequence the pizza stone cover (1)
and the base (2) on which it is placed. The base
has to be lifted a few millimetres, then pulled
outwards.
Lift the end of the lower heating element (3) a
few centimetres and clean the oven base.
Put the pizza stone base back in place, pushing
it in until it hits the back of the oven, and push it
down so that the heating element plate is
embedded into the base itself.
Cleaning the pizza stone
The pizza stone should be washed separately
according to the following instructions:
The stone must be cleaned after every use. Do
not heat it again if it has any encrustations. To
clean, pour 50 cc of vinegar onto the stone,
leave it to act for 10 minutes, then remove it by
wiping with a metallic mesh or abrasive sponge.
Rinse with water then leave to dry.
Before cleaning, remove any dirt burnt onto
the stone with the aid of a metal spatula or a
scraper of the kind used for cleaning glass
ceramic hobs.
For best results, the stone must still be warm;
otherwise, wash it in hot water.
Use metal mesh sponges or abrasive
scotch-brite pads, dipped in lemon or
vinegar.
Never use detergents.
Never wash in the dishwasher.
Never leave the stone to soak.
The damp stone must not be used for a least
8 hours after the end of the cleaning
procedures.
Over time, slight cracks may appear on the
surface of the stone. This is due to the normal
expansion caused by high temperatures of
the enamel coating the stone.
Vapor Clean (on some models only)
Preliminary operations
Before starting the Vapor Clean cycle:
Completely remove all accessories from
inside the oven.
Remove the temperature probe, if present.
Remove the self-cleaning panels, if present.
Pour approx. 120 cc of water onto the floor
of the oven. Make sure it does not overflow
out of the cavity.
Spray a water and washing up liquid
solution inside the oven using a spray
nozzle. Direct the spray towards the side
walls, upwards, downwards and towards
the deflector.
See General safety instructions.
The Vapor Clean function is an assisted
cleaning procedure that facilitates the
removal of dirt. Thanks to this process, it
is possible to clean the inside of the
oven very easily. The dirt residues are
softened by the heat and water vapour
for easier removal afterwards.
We recommend spraying approx. 20
times at the most.
Do not spray the deflector if it has a self-
cleaning coating.
